Dwight McNeil has come a long way in a short space of time as he prepares to face Bournemouth again.
The Clarets’ winger made his Premier League debut against the Cherries as a late substitute on the final day of the 2017/18 season as Burnley headed into Europe.
The 20-year-old had signed a first professional contract only a month earlier.
And now as he prepares for a reunion with Eddie Howe’s men – having watched last season’s 4-0 home win from the bench – he is in line to make his 49th Premier League appearance and extend his ever-present record this term.
